The main sources of air pollution in Zeeland are shipping and industry. The air quality in Zeeland meets the EU limit values. This is evident from research conducted by GGD Zeeland on behalf of the Province of Zeeland and the municipality of Terneuzen.
Even at low exposure to air pollutants such as fine particulate matter, health effects already occur, concludes Yvonne Bosch, researcher and advisor Environment & Health at GGD Zeeland. In her research on air quality and health in Zeeland, she emphasizes that sustained and additional efforts are needed to keep and improve the air quality in Zeeland.
Deputy Daniëlle de Clerck: The air quality has already improved in recent years. And in Zeeland, the quality is on average more favorable than in large parts of the Netherlands. As a Province, we are already working on the implementation of the Clean Air Agreement. But this report makes it clear that this topic must remain high on the agenda. And it clearly shows what governments, but also residents themselves, can do.
